AXEL KLEIDON Axel Kleidon

Thermodynamics sets fundamental laws for all physical processes and is central to driving and maintaining planetary dynamics. But how do Earth system processes perform work, where do they derive energy from, and what are the ultimate limits? Sean A. Hartnoll

We propose a dual thermodynamic description of a classical instability of generalised black hole spacetimes. From a thermodynamic perspective, the instability is due to negative compressibility in regions where the Casimir pressure is large. Jing Chen J. Chen

Human societies are complex thermodynamic systems. It is natural to ask to what extent results obtained from simple thermodynamic systems can be extended to provide insights into more complex thermodynamic systems. H. Reiss

An effort is made to introduce thermodynamic and statistical thermodynamic methods into the treatment of nonphysical (e.g., social, economic, etc.) systems. Emphasis is placed on the use of the entire thermodynamic framework, not merely entropy.
